A Rape, Abuse & Incest National Network (RAINN): 1-800-656-HOPE You can also get help online at RAINN's website: https://www.rainn.org
If you or someone you know has experienced sexual assault, please remember that you are not alone. The Rape, Abuse & Incest National Network (RAINN) is a crucial support dedicated to providing aid and advocacy for survivors of sexual violence. RAINN's dedicated staff members are available day and night to offer confidential support through their national helpline at 1-800-656-HOPE.
Furthermore, RAINN's website, https://www.rainn.org, offers a wealth of resources for survivors, family, and the general public. The website provides guidance on various topics related to sexual assault, including healing resources.
